USA Castellano - Chile Sep 25, … Web9 nov. 2024 · May 16, 2024 at 15:43. Kant is clear that in treating persons as means in the acceptable way outlined, we are also treating them as ends. Treating them merely as means excludes treating them as ends. There's a difference between treating them as ends-and-means and treating them not as ends but only as means. inciweb peak fire https://aurinkoaodottamassa.com

Web27 apr. 2024 · Mere noun. A body of standing water, such as a lake or a pond. More specifically, it can refer to a lake that is broad in relation to its depth. Also included in place names such as Windermere. Merely adverb. (obsolete) Wholly, entirely. Mere noun. Boundary, limit; a boundary-marker; boundary-line.
